2. DESCRIPCIÓN GENERAL DEL PRODUCTO
Este producto es un completo, diseñado 250300planta trituradora de piedra tph, configured as a stationary or modular system for highvolume aggregate production. The typical workflow is engineered for efficiency: (1) Primary reduction via a robust jaw crusher or gyratory crusher to handle large feed (hasta ~750 mm). (2) Cribado intermedio y trituración secundaria, often using a highperformance cone crusher for shape correction. (3) Tertiary crushing and final sizing through additional cone crushers or vertical shaft impactors (VSI) to achieve specific product cubicity. (4) Multideck screening for precise product separation into finished aggregates (p.ej., 05milímetros, 510milímetros, 1020milímetros, 2031.5milímetros). (5) Integrated conveyor system with centralised dust suppression.
Ámbito de aplicación: Ideal para operaciones de canteras grandes, grandes proyectos de infraestructura (autopistas, ferrocarriles), y plantas comerciales de hormigón/asfalto que requieren, highspecification aggregates.
Limitaciones: This capacity range is not suited for smallscale operations or highly confined urban sites without significant space planning. Optimal performance requires consistent feed material analysis and proper upstream loading equipment.

5. ESPECIFICACIONES TÉCNICAS
Capacidad de rendimiento diseñada: 250 300 toneladas métricas por hora (275 330 toneladas estadounidenses por hora), based on standard granite with bulk density of ~1.6 t/m³.
Opciones de trituradora primaria: Cursor de mandíbula (Apertura de alimentación de hasta 1200x900 mm.) o trituradora de cono primaria.
Etapa Secundaria/Terciaria: One or two units of HighPerformance Cone Crushers with hydraulic adjustment.
Etapa de selección: Múltiples cribas vibratorias de servicio pesado (typically two or three units), size up to 2.4m x 6m tripledeck.
Potencia Total Instalada: Aproximadamente 550 650 kilovatios, depending on final configuration.
Especificaciones clave de materiales: Estructura del marco principal fabricada en acero S355JR.; Revestimientos de trituradora disponibles en aleaciones de inserción Mn18Cr2 o TIC; Mallas de malla de alambre de alta resistencia o poliuretano..
Huella aproximada: Varía según el diseño.; typical Lshaped configuration requires ~65m x 55m area.
Rango de operación ambiental: Diseñado para temperaturas ambiente de 20°C a +45°C; control de emisiones de polvo para <50 mg/Nm³; sound pressure level at periphery <85 dB(A).
